Transaction 531da4e213862372987b125dddbc2e88b9fec5fa5f8e6d9137311cb7fb6554ba

24 Input
2 Outputs
  • 531da4e213862372987b125dddbc2e88b9fec5fa5f8e6d9137311cb7fb6554ba:0
  • value  32882360
    address  16kfESsd7mrfwZCqT28S3SzZpCD8w9Z4du
  • 531da4e213862372987b125dddbc2e88b9fec5fa5f8e6d9137311cb7fb6554ba:1
  • value  145729
    address  1BgYnRFnayTt94DknVVJAfz9geB7mYs4ow